Abstract :
High direct-voltage ramp tests, according to IEEE Std 95, are used to evaluate the condition of groundwall insulation in rotating machine windings. Evidence of possible defects has been found involving asphalt, polyester and epoxy bonded insulation systems. Some results reflect lack of cure or environmental conditions while other results are indicative of serious groundwall defects which may fail while the machine is in service. Action taken on the basis of the test results is discussed
